We are looking for a visionary Platforms Director to lead our Global Enterprise Shared Platforms team. In this pivotal role, you will be responsible for the strategic direction, reliability, and continuous improvement of our platforms, ensuring we deliver exceptional service and drive technological innovation.
The Platforms Director will manage cross-functional teams of Technical Architects, Engineers, and other technical professionals. You will be accountable for managing the infrastructure budget, leading R&D initiatives, and fostering a culture of innovation within the team.
Scope of Platforms
* Enterprise CI/CD: Continuous Integration and Continuous Deployment pipelines.
* Observability Platform: Based on the ELK stack (Elasticsearch, Logstash, Kibana) for comprehensive monitoring and logging.
* Data Streaming Platform: Leveraging Kafka for real-time data ingestion and processing.
* Enterprise Cross-Cloud Kubernetes Capability: Utilizing GKE (Google Kubernetes Engine) to manage containerized applications across multiple cloud providers and environments.
* Enterprise In-Memory Databases: Based on Redis for high-speed data caching and session management.
* Enterprise Generative AI Platform.

For more information, please visit **************************** We DoWe are looking for an innovative and proactive Senior Security Architect to lead the strategic planning, implementation, and ongoing enhancement of First American's security framework. This pivotal role requires a blend of strong technical proficiency and effective business leadership. The ideal candidate will develop and articulate a robust security strategy encompassing network, application, identity, data and cloud environments, ensuring proactive management of cyber risks. Provide long-term solutions to Information Security Technology needs, including protecting information and information systems from unauthorized access, use, disclosure, disruption, modification, perusal, inspection, recording or destruction.
This role will be hybrid two days per week onsite in Santa Ana, CA.
What You'll Do
Cloud Security Architecture & Zero Trust Design:
Lead the design and implementation of Zero Trust security models within multi-cloud environments (Azure, AWS, GCP) to implement Zero Trust principles within the organization's cloud infrastructure. This includes securing data, network access, identities, applications, privatization of workloads and network micro-segmentation based on the principle of least privilege.
Governance Models for Security:
a. Application Security Governance
: Collaborate with Application Security Architects to design and enforce application security governance models that integrate secure software development practices, secure APIs, and application-level access controls.
b. Identity and Access Management (IAM):
Collaborate with Identity Architects to design and enforce comprehensive IAM policies as part of the Zero Trust model, ensuring least-privilege access evolving to JIT Just-In-Time based access, strong authentication mechanisms (including multi-factor authentication), password less authentication, and identity federation across cloud platforms (Entra ID, AWS IAM, GCP Identity).
c. Data Governance:
Collaborate with Data Architects to develop and enforce governance models that protect sensitive and critical data within cloud environments
Cloud Security Risk Management:
Identify and mitigate security risks associated with cloud deployments and continuously improve security posture in line with Zero Trust principles.
Cloud Security Posture Management:
Regulate policy enforcement, monitor compliance, and implement remediation strategies based on Prisma Cloud findings to improve cloud security posture. Configure and manage Prisma Cloud policies to monitor and identify misconfigurations, vulnerabilities, and threats in cloud infrastructure, applications, and services.
Security Automation & Orchestration: Utilize automation tools to integrate security controls into cloud workflows as part of Dev-Sec-Ops model. Automate deployment of security policies and governance models using Infrastructure as Code (IaC) tools ensuring security consistency across cloud resources
Continuous Improvement: Stay up to date with the latest cloud security threats, trends, and technologies.
